What can you compost?
● Fruit and vegetable peels such as potatoes, bananas, and apples are compostable. (Chopping or shredding them will help to speed up the decomposition process.)
● Eggshells are compostable but can take longer than some other items to break down. Crushing them down will help to speed up the process.
● Coffee grounds and tea leaves
(tea bags should be emptied and only tea leaves used for compost)
○ Avoid citrus fruits such as oranges, lemons, and limes. These can be acidic and can kill off microorganisms that help decomposition. You should also avoid tomatoes and pickled vegetables for the same reasons.
○ No meat, fish, or grease should be included
We have plenty of browns (leaves, paper, etc.)
